Energy companies often have field engineers and technicians working at remote sites like oil rigs, refineries, or renewable energy farms.
Kasm can provide browser-based access to corporate systems, SCADA dashboards, and data visualization tools without requiring a full VPN or installing software on unmanaged devices.
Minimizes the attack surface, ensures compliance, and allows quick access from anywhere while maintaining security.
Energy operations produce massive amounts of telemetry and sensor data (IoT from pipelines, turbines, or grids).
Analysts and engineers can access Jupyter notebooks, GIS mapping tools, or custom dashboards inside Kasm Workspaces.
The workspaces run in secure containers, so sensitive operational data never leaves the server environment—reducing risk of leaks.
Global energy enterprises rely on distributed offices to coordinate exploration, production, compliance, and trading. Legacy VDI solutions often struggle with performance, cost, and scalability across regions.
Staff in Houston, Dubai, London, or Singapore can securely access ERP, compliance, and project management systems through Kasm Workspaces as a lightweight alternative.
Browser-based sessions eliminate endpoint data storage, reduce infrastructure overhead, and ensure data sovereignty by streaming from regional infrastructure. This improves performance, simplifies IT delivery, and lowers total cost of ownership compared to legacy VDI.
Companies frequently work with third-party contractors, consultants, and regulators.
Instead of provisioning accounts or issuing hardware, Kasm allows external users to securely access virtual desktops or single applications through a browser.
Rapid onboarding/offboarding of partners with strong security controls and audit logging.
AI is rapidly evolving. AI initiatives in enterprises bring unique data-security risks (IP leakage, training data exposure, regulatory non-compliance). Kasm acts as a security perimeter for AI by keeping sensitive data in controlled, ephemeral, and auditable environments. This ensures that AI can be leveraged without exposing internal data to uncontrolled endpoints, external SaaS models, or insider threats.
AI workloads often require access to highly sensitive datasets for training (e.g., SCADA telemetry in energy, financial transactions, internal scheduling information). Giving direct local access increases insider risk. Instead of distributing datasets, Kasm delivers secure desktops/applications where data stays in the data center or cloud VPC. Access is controlled via role-based access, audit logs, and session recording.
Enforces “data-never-leaves” compliance posture while still empowering data scientists to work flexibly.
